I understand in the real world, but within the context of this game "How is raising Quality helpful? Why do people pay more for higher quality goods? What can a high quality product do that a q0 product can't?"
"Do q0 vs q1 vs q2 relate to one another... meaning is q1 100% higher quality q2 200% higher quality or is it teared some other way?

I will try to help you out here, but I am not an admin or anything like that, so take it for what it is worth.

The higher the end quality on any product, the faster you can sell it in your stores.

For example...You can sell 5000 gas with quality 0 in 24 hours.
If you raise your gas quality to 1, you can now sell the same amount of gas at the same size store in maybe 20 hours. (these are all just example numbers, I have no idea what the effects are for all products)

This allows you to sell your gas for more money in a 24 hour period, or restock your shelves twice a day, instead of once.

Also customers are happier with your service if you match or beat the average quality of that product in that Area (Germany, Saudi...etc)
Happier customers spend more money.

Yes, Epistel is right... and furthermore you should keep one issue in mind: later on in the game, the average quality of a product will increase. So lets say, average quality in Germany for apples is according to the stats 30.... it will be very difficult to sell q0 then and, what is more, imagine the price for those q0 ones...
